“There was once a man that thought he was dead. His concerned wife and friends sent him to a doctor. The doctor decided to cure him by convincing him of one fact that contradicted “his belief” that he was dead. The doctor “used the simple truth” that dead men don’t bleed. The doctor put his patient to work reading medical texts, observing autopsies, etc. After weeks of effort the patient finally said, “All right! All right! You have me convinced. “Dead men don’t bleed!” Whereupon the doctor struck him in the arm with a needle, and the blood flowed. The man looked down with a contorted face and cried, “Good Grief! Dead men bleed after all!”
